Batman Noir: The Long Halloween #[nn]
In "New Year's Eve," the shadow of Gotham’s Holiday killer looms large as Alberto Falcone’s confession seems to bring closure—only for Harvey Dent to unleash the city’s most dangerous inmates from Arkham, leading to Carmine Falcone’s brutal death. Batman moves swiftly to contain the chaos, but as the dust settles, one question remains: was Alberto truly the Holiday killer, or is a darker truth still buried beneath the city’s lies? Written by Jeph Loeb and illustrated with chilling precision by Tim Sale, this noir-infused chapter of Batman Noir: The Long Halloween deepens the mystery with a cover by Tim Sale that captures the story’s grim, rain-slicked atmosphere.

Alberto Falcone is captured and confesses to all the Holiday murders. Harvey frees the worst villains in Arkham and they kill Carmine Falcone. All are captured by Batman and returned to Arkham. But was Alberto truly the Holiday killer?
